Contribute FeedbackLocated in Cudahy, this restaurant presents a mixed bag of experiences. Visitors have faced frustrating service issues, such as confusing wait protocols and slow order fulfillment, with some reporting forgotten items. The ambience has been described as dark and cluttered, resembling a poorly organized swap meet. However, there are shining stars among the staff; patrons have singled out employees like Jose and Monse for their exceptional service, highlighting their friendliness and professionalism. While the location shows promise with its mobile ordering and ample parking, operational inconsistencies overshadow the positive aspects, leaving a disappointing impression on many.
